What is a maraboo spell?

A maraboo spell, often referred to as a "marabout" spell, is a type of magic or charm rooted in West African and Islamic traditions. It typically involves the use of prayers, amulets, or rituals performed by a marabout, a spiritual leader or healer, to invoke protection, healing, or blessings. These spells can be used for various purposes, including love, prosperity, and protection from harm. The practice is deeply intertwined with cultural beliefs and local customs.
